Python生成Excel超链接工具的创新应用
需积分: 1 35 浏览量
更新于2024-11-23
收藏 5.45MB RAR 举报
资源摘要信息: "excel 超链接+Python实现工具" 是一个实用的exe小工具,旨在简化在Excel中创建超链接的过程。通过这款工具,用户可以方便地获取指定目录下文件的超链接公式,并将其输出为txt文件格式。这样,用户只需要将txt文件中的内容复制并粘贴到Excel中,即可快速生成超链接,从而访问文件系统中的相应文件或网页。
在详细阐述该工具的应用和实现前,我们需要了解一些与Excel超链接相关的基本知识点:
1. Excel超链接的概念:在Excel中,超链接是一种特殊的文本或对象,用户可以通过点击它来访问某个文件、网页或其他位置。超链接通常显示为带有下划线的蓝色文本,并且鼠标悬停时通常会显示为手形指针。
2. 创建Excel超链接的方法:通常情况下,用户可以通过手动输入超链接公式或使用Excel的“插入超链接”功能来创建超链接。手动输入的公式通常是“=HYPERLINK("链接地址","显示文本")”。例如:“=HYPERLINK("***", "访问官网")”会在单元格中创建一个指向“***”的链接,并以“访问官网”作为显示文本。
3. Python在Excel自动化中的应用:Python是一种广泛应用于数据处理和自动化的编程语言,可以利用诸如openpyxl、xlwings等库实现对Excel文件的操作。这些库允许开发者编写脚本或程序来自动化Excel的常规任务,包括创建超链接。
根据上述信息,我们可以推断出"excel 超链接+Python实现工具"可能实现的具体功能和涉及的知识点:
1. 使用Python脚本自动化过程:工具的核心是一个Python脚本,它通过访问文件系统的API来获取指定目录下的文件列表,并为每个文件生成一个超链接公式。
2. 目录遍历:工具需要遍历用户指定的目录,获取目录中所有文件的路径信息。这通常涉及到文件系统操作的知识,比如使用Python的os模块或pathlib模块。
3. 超链接公式的生成:Python脚本将遍历得到的文件路径转换为Excel超链接的格式。这意味着脚本需要处理字符串格式化,将路径转换成"=HYPERLINK("链接地址","显示文本")"形式的字符串。
4. 输出为txt文件:生成的超链接公式需要以文本文件形式保存,这样用户可以将其内容复制粘贴到Excel中。这涉及到文件操作,包括使用Python的文件读写功能。
5. 文件路径的处理:在创建超链接公式时,需要确保文件路径的正确性,以保证超链接指向的文件是有效的。这可能需要处理不同操作系统下的路径差异,以及确保文件路径的格式与Excel超链接兼容。
6. 用户界面设计:尽管这是一款命令行工具,但仍可能需要一个简单的用户界面来接收用户输入的目录路径,并指示程序执行结果。
7. 程序的打包与分发:最终,Python脚本需要被编译成exe文件,以便用户可以在没有安装Python环境的情况下使用它。这一过程涉及到使用PyInstaller或其他打包工具的知识。
综上所述,"excel 超链接+Python实现工具"是一个利用Python进行Excel超链接自动化生成的实用工具,它解决了手动创建超链接繁琐且易出错的问题,提高了工作效率。通过上述知识点的介绍,我们可以更好地理解这款工具的工作原理和实现方法。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2022-06-06 上传
2021-02-13 上传
2020-12-24 上传
2022-07-03 上传
2019-08-10 上传
2018-04-12 上传
shuiqinghan2012
- 粉丝: 122
- 资源: 4
最新资源
- 数字单片机数字单片机
- D语言编程参考手册1.0
- JAVA程序员面试题解惑
- cognos8.12学习资料
- Intel双核与超线程的区别与联系
- 如何编写LINUX 驱动
- Apache与多个Tomcat服务器集成时的负载平衡.txt
- GCC中文手册,详细介绍GCC
- GCC中文手册,详细介绍GCC
- Cross-words Reference Template for DTW-based Speech Recognition Systems
- 一份不太简短的LaTex介绍
- Linux 常用指令大全
- 计算机毕业论文(试题库管理系统)
- 综合电子仿真与设计项目
- XX公司网络设计方案doc
- Oracle Biee Catalog合并